On Wed, Aug 11, 2021 at 03:54:42PM -0700, Randy Dunlap wrote:
Top-level Makefile targets 'versioncheck' and 'includecheck' don't
need a configured kernel (i.e., don't need a .config file), so add
them the the list of "no-dot-config-targets".
This eliminates the 'make' error:

***
*** Configuration file ".config" not found!
***
*** Please run some configurator (e.g. "make oldconfig" or
*** "make menuconfig" or "make xconfig").
***
Makefile:759: include/config/auto.conf.cmd: No such file or directory
